Did you know?
The term Mushin comes from the Japanese 無心 and literally means “without thought”. It’s a state of mind that all Karateka must strive for in their daily practice. This is undoubtedly one of the meanings of “Kara” (空 = emptiness) in Karate.
In the Mushin state, the mind attaches itself to no thought and works very quickly instinctively. The absence of thought enables it to act and react in a flash without being disturbed by any judgment. As the mind is not fixed or occupied by thought or emotion, it is open to everything.
In fact, Mushin is a state of mental clarity produced by the absence of ego.
Mushin must be worked on in Kata and Kumite, even in competition, in order to approach perfection.
